Landscape Hardscaping in Boston, MA
Landscape hardscaping services focus on designing and installing durable, functional features that enhance outdoor spaces. This includes projects such as patios, walkways, retaining walls, driveways, fire pits, and outdoor kitchens. Homeowners often seek these services to create inviting outdoor living areas, improve property aesthetics, and add practical elements that increase usability and value. Understanding the scope of hardscaping work, the materials involved, and the overall design goals can help property owners plan effectively before requesting services.
Before requesting landscape hardscaping, property owners should consider the specific features they want to include, the intended use of the space, and any existing landscape elements that may influence the project. It’s also helpful to evaluate the property’s terrain, drainage needs, and local regulations that might affect installation. Clear communication about desired outcomes and budget expectations can ensure the project aligns with the homeowner’s vision for their outdoor environment.

Common Landscape Hardscaping Jobs
Patio installation - creating functional and attractive outdoor living spaces with durable hardscape materials.
Walkway construction - designing and building pathways that improve accessibility and enhance curb appeal.
Retaining walls - providing structural support and defining landscape levels for stability and visual interest.
Driveway paving - installing or resurfacing driveways with concrete or pavers for a smooth, long-lasting surface.
Fire pits and outdoor kitchens - adding functional features to extend outdoor living and entertainment options.
Landscape edging - defining garden beds and lawn boundaries for a clean, organized appearance.
Landscape Hardscaping Questions
What is landscape hardscaping? Landscape hardscaping involves installing non-living elements like patios, walkways, retaining walls, and other structures to enhance outdoor spaces.
What types of projects are common in hardscaping? Common projects include creating patios, installing stone pathways, building retaining walls, and designing outdoor living areas.
How does hardscaping improve a property? Hardscaping adds functional and aesthetic features that increase usability, define spaces, and improve curb appeal.
What materials are used in hardscaping? Materials such as stone, brick, concrete, and pavers are typically used for durable and attractive hardscape features.
